Severe gastric impaction in an 8-Year-old Nigerian local dog

CP Mshelia, JB Adeyanju, AA Abubakar, AS Yakubu, A Jibril, MY Kolo, S Garba, MS Jibrin & AG Balami.




Abstract

An 8-year old male, neutered Nigerian indigenous dog was presented to the Usmanu Danfodiyo University Veterinary Teaching Hospital, Sokoto because of chronic intermittent vomiting, off feed and progressive wasting. Physical examination of the abdomen revealed hard mass in the abdominal cavity. Survey abdominal radiography (lateral view) revealed impacted material along with electrical wire in the stomach. Standard gastrotomy was successfully performed to evacuate the gastric foreign body.
